GoTo Group

Senior Data Engineer

Sep 05, 2023

Jakarta

About the Role

As a Senior Data Engineer, you need to design and develop robust end-to-end data solutions for structured and unstructured data including, but not limited to, ingestion, parsing, integration, auditing, logging, aggregation, normalization, modeling, and error handling.

By leveraging data across GoTo Ecosystem, you will Interact directly with end users to gather requirements and consult on data integration solutions and collaborate with a cross functional team to resolve data quality and operational issues. 

What You Will Do :

  • Gather business requirement to support GoTo CDP Project
  • Explore existing and new data sources and facilitate the integration to the Data Warehouse
  • Design and develop Data Quality Framework across Data Platform
  • Design, implement Data Model for enterprise data warehouse
  • Classifying data based Data Governance policy and Data Access Framework
  • Develop data definition and metrics and maintain the consistency across Data team
  • Modify existing structured and unstructured data integration solutions for rapidly evolving business needs.
  • Collaborate with a cross-functional team to resolve data quality and operational issues.
  • Create conceptual models and data flow diagrams.
  • Participate with end users to gather requirements and consult on data integration solutions.
  • Receive and adhere to project delivery deadlines.  
  • Migrate code across environments and leverage a source code management system.
  • Develop and maintain proper documentation for data pipeline and service

What You Will Need :

  •  A Bachelor’s Degree in Computer Science or a related field preferred
  • 2+ years of Data Integration experience.
  • 2+ years of hands-on experience with one of the following technologies:  Hadoop, Apache Spark, SQL or Redshift or PostgreSQL
  • Having experience in GCP Products like Bigquery, Dataflow, PubSub, Bigtable, Composer, and GCS is a plus
  • Proficiency in traditional RDBMS with an emphasis on Postgres, and MySQL.
  • General understanding of ETL/ELT frameworks, error handling techniques, data quality techniques and their overall operation
  • Generally proficient in performing data transformations via scripting, stored procedures, or an ETL framework.
  • Proficient in developing and supporting all aspects of a big data cluster: Ingestion, Processing, integration (Python, Spark, Scala), data cleansing, workflow management (OOZIE and ActiveBatch, Airflow), and querying (SQL).
  • Proficiency in at least one of the following programming languages: Java, Python, Go and Scala.
  • Experience in writing Apache Spark or Apache Beam including an understanding of optimization techniques.
  • Proficient in Unix and Linux operating systems
  • Capable of navigating and working effectively in a DevOps model including leveraging related technologies: Jenkins, GitLab, Git etc.

About the teams

Working with us will be a challenging yet rewarding and fun experience. You’ll be exposed to many different use cases, and will be supported by eager and friendly colleagues and leaders across GoTo Group.. You will also be involved in many discussions as our team loves to share and hear from others regardings problems and goals we want to achieve, bringing to the the journey of #GoFarGoTogether

About GoTo Group

GoTo Group is the largest digital ecosystem in Indonesia with its mission to “Empower Progress’ by offering technological infrastructure and solutions for everyone to access and thrive in the digital economy. The GoTo ecosystem consists of on-demand transportation services, e-commerce, food and grocery delivery, logistics and fulfillment, as well as financial and payment services through the Gojek, Tokopedia and GoTo Financial platforms.It is the first platform in Southeast Asia that hosts these crucial cases in a single ecosystem, capturing the majority of Indonesia’s vast consumer household.

About Gojek 

Gojek is Southeast Asia’s leading on-demand platform and pioneer of the multi-service ecosystem with over 2.5 million driver partners across the regions offering a wide range of services such as transportation, food delivery, logistics and more. With its mission to create impact at scale, Gojek is committed to resolving consumer problems and raising standards of living by connecting consumers to the best providers of goods and services in the market.

About GoTo Financial

GoTo Financial accelerates financial inclusion through its leading financial services and merchants solutions. Its consumer services include GoPay and GoPayLater and serve businesses of all sizes through Midtrans, Moka, GoBiz Plus, GoBiz, and Selly. With its trusted and inclusive ecosystem of products, GoTo Financial is open to new growth opportunities and aims to empower everyone to Make It Happen, Make It Together, Make It Last.

About Tokopedia  

Tokopedia is an Indonesian technology company with a mission to democratize commerce through technology. It has been a driving force behind Indonesia's digital development since its foundation in 2009, with more than 99% of districts and empowered around 12 million merchants listed nationwide. With Nakama ranging all across Indonesia, Tokopedia aims to simplify the lives of many to #FindYourPurpose together.

GoTo and its business units, including Gojek, Tokopedia, GoToFinancial and GoToLogistics ("GoTo") only post job opportunities on our official channels on our respective company websites and on LinkedIn. GoTo is not liable for any job postings or job offers that did not originate from us. You should conduct your own due diligence to prevent being victims of any fake job scams, if they did not originate from GoTo's official recruitment channels.

Join 27213+ Machine Learning Engineers, receiving daily job alerts.